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Вопросы к итоговой аттестации.docx
Скачиваний:
0
Добавлен:
28.08.2019
Размер:
28.95 Кб
Скачать

Вопросы к итоговой аттестации

По дисциплине «Базы данных»

  1. Концепция баз данных. Понятия баз данных, СУБД. Архитектура СУБД. Реляционная структура данных, ее достоинства. Основные понятия: отношение, атомарное значение, домен, кортеж, степень отношения. Первичные и альтернативные ключи.

  2. Основные этапы проектирования реляционных баз данных.

  3. Основы технологии работы в СУБД. Типовая структура интерфейса.

  4. Основные этапы работы с СУБД: создание структуры базы данных, основные типы данных. Ввод и редактирование данных.

  5. Создание таблиц в Access. Особенности работы с таблицами, основные приемы. Создание мгновенных баз данных: основные объекты, окно.

  6. Создание связей между таблицами. Схема данных. Установление связей между таблицами с помощью Мастера подстановок.

  7. Конструирование таблицы: изменение и задание свойств полей.

  8. Использование маски ввода для задания свойств полей.

  9. Задание условий на значение поля, задание свойств таблицы.

  10. Формы: создание, основные функций. Фильтрация записей.

  11. Представление в форме взаимосвязанных данных. Подчиненная форма.

  12. Вычисления в форме.

  13. Расширенный фильтр. Сложные фильтры и сортировки.

  14. Правила записи выражений в Access. Построитель выражений.

  15. Создание мгновенных форм. Автоформы.

  16. Поиск данных в форме или таблице. Поиск информации с помощью запросов.

  17. Отбор записей с помощью конструктора запросов. Подведение итогов по записям.

  18. Групповая обработка данных в запросах.

  19. Общие правила добавления элементов управления в форму с помощью панели инструментов. Установка связи между элементом и полем.

  20. Форматирование элементов управления в форме: выравнивание, изменение размеров, цвета, спецэффекты.

  21. Связывание и внедрение объектов в форму, отчет. Технология OLE.

  22. Создание управляющего элемента с меняющимся от записи к записи изображением.

  23. Создание в форме надписей. Создание диаграммы в форме.

  24. Ключи и индексы в Access, их создание и использование.

  25. Создание отчетов.

  26. Защита баз данных.

  27. Усовершенствование баз данных.

По дисциплине «Технология разработки программных продуктов»

  1. Основные понятия программного обеспечения. Свойства алгоритма решения задачи.

  2. Программа. Программное средство. Программная документация. Технология программирования.

  3. Неконструктивность понятия правильной программы.

  4. Надежность программного средства.

  5. Технология программирования как технология разработки надежных программных средств.

  6. Технология программирования и информатизация общества.

  7. Сопровождение программного продукта.

  8. Характеристики программных продуктов.

  9. Модели процесса создания ПО.

  10. Структура жизненного цикла программы.

  11. Понятие качества программного средства.

  12. Обеспечение надежности.

  13. Методы борьбы со сложностью. Обеспечение точности перевода. Контроль принимаемых решений.

  14. Спецификация ПО. Проектирование и реализация ПО.

  15. Архитектура программного средства.

  16. Основные классы архитектур программных средств.

  17. Архитектурные функции. Контроль архитектуры программных средств.

  18. Источники ошибок в программных средствах.

  19. Структурирование. Методы структурирования программ.

  20. Основные понятия ООП.

  21. Методика ООП.

  22. Структурное проектирование и программирование.

  23. Классификация методов проектирования программных продуктов.

  24. Этапы создания программных продуктов.

  25. Структура программных продуктов.

  26. Структурное программирование. Контроль структуры программы.

  27. Метод восходящей разработки. Метод нисходящей разработки.

  28. Разработка программного модуля.

  29. Пошаговая детализация и понятие о псевдокоде. Контроль программного модуля.

  30. Стиль программирования.

  31. Тестирование программного обеспечения: тестирование дефектов.

  32. Защита программного обеспечения.